From 824be84dd3aaa72a0d01241439f41733a4a1b742 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: "Jason A. Donenfeld" Date: Tue, 29 Nov 2016 23:28:14 +0100 Subject: hashtable: use random number each time Otherwise timing information might leak information about prior index entries. We also switch back to an explicit uint64_t because siphash needs something at least that size. (This partially reverts 1550e9ba597946c88e3e7e3e8dcf33c13dd76e5b.
